JEE Maths Solutions – Complex Numbers are designed to help students master one of the most important and conceptually rich topics in Algebra for JEE Main and JEE Advanced. Complex Numbers provide a powerful extension of real numbers and play a significant role in higher mathematics, engineering, physics, and signal processing. Questions from this chapter are frequently asked in competitive examinations, making it an essential topic for JEE aspirants.

The chapter begins with the introduction of imaginary and complex numbers, where students learn the concept of i=−1? and how complex numbers are represented in the form a+ib. Students gain a clear understanding of the real part, imaginary part, conjugate, modulus, and argument of a complex number. These concepts form the foundation for solving advanced algebraic problems involving complex numbers.

A major focus of the chapter is the Argand Plane, which provides a geometric representation of complex numbers. Students learn how to plot complex numbers, determine distances, and interpret algebraic operations geometrically. Understanding the Argand plane helps in visualizing complex number relationships and solving locus-based questions that are commonly asked in JEE Advanced.

The chapter also covers important operations such as addition, subtraction, multiplication, division, and powers of complex numbers. Students learn techniques involving De Moivre’s Theorem, polar form, and trigonometric representation of complex numbers. These concepts simplify complex calculations and help solve higher-level problems efficiently.

Another important area is the application of complex numbers in solving quadratic equations and polynomial equations. Students learn how complex roots occur in conjugate pairs and how they are used in algebraic problem-solving. Advanced JEE questions often combine complex numbers with coordinate geometry, trigonometry, and algebra, making a strong conceptual understanding extremely important.
